Reason 2: The Clean Is Deeper and Smarter Than DIY Professional cleaners bring trained technique that is difficult for an average homeowner to match. They know which products suit natural stone versus laminate, how to clean stainless steel without streaks, and the right method for stubborn soap scum on glass shower doors, which prevents costly damage from the wrong chemical or an abrasive sponge. They also arrive with commercial-grade equipment: high-powered vacuums with HEPA filters capture a far higher percentage of dust, allergens, and pet dander, improving indoor air quality for households with allergy sufferers, asthmatics, children, or pets. The process itself is systematic. Cleaners work from a detailed checklist, top to bottom so falling dust lands before floors are addressed, and side to side across each room. A standard recurring visit covers comprehensive dusting of furniture, shelves, and window sills; cleaning and disinfecting of kitchen countertops, sinks, and appliance exteriors; scrubbing toilets, showers, tubs, and vanities; plus vacuuming carpets and mopping hard floors. Reason 3: Deep Cleans and Move Days Stop Being Dreaded Homes that have gone a while without a thorough clean, and clients new to a service, often start with a deep clean, the reset button. It includes everything in a standard visit, then goes further: washing baseboards and trim, cleaning light fixtures and ceiling fans, wiping doors and frames, reaching behind and underneath furniture and appliances, scrubbing grout lines, and cleaning interior window surfaces. Specialized move services matter just as much. A move-out clean is the most exhaustive of all, performed on an empty home down to cabinet and drawer interiors, closets, the oven, and the refrigerator. It is frequently a requirement for retrieving a security deposit, and it presents the property at its best for agents and buyers. A move-in clean lets you start your new chapter in a sanitized, freshly prepared space, peace of mind before a single box is unpacked. Reason 4: Vetted People and Real Protection The biggest hesitation about letting anyone into your home is trust, and reputable companies engineer that trust deliberately. They background-check and thoroughly vet their employees, then stand behind the work with bonding and insurance. Bonding provides protection against theft, while insurance covers accidental damage during a clean, so you are working with an organization accountable for its people and its work. Customization is part of the relationship too: a good company builds a plan around your needs, priorities, and budget, whether that means a weekly, bi-weekly, or monthly visit, a focus on just the kitchen and bathrooms, or a request for eco-friendly products. You pay for what you actually need.
